/*
   Site design & kode by Businessprodesigns
		  www.businessprodesigns.com
*/

/*---------- CSS RESET -----------*/

html,body,div,ul,li,p,h1,h2,h3,span,form,input,select,label,text-area,a,img{ margin:0px; padding:0px;}
ul, li{ list-style-image:none; list-style-type:none;}
img a{border:none; outline:none;}
a{text-decoration:none;}

@font-face {
	font-family: 'Square721BTRoman';
	src: url('../fonts/square_721_bt-webfont.eot');
	src: local('Square721BTRoman'), url('../fonts/square_721_bt-webfont.woff') format('woff'), url('../fonts/square_721_bt-webfont.ttf') format('truetype'), 
	url('../fonts/square_721_bt-webfont.svg#webfontbxsg8851') format('svg');
	font-weight: normal;
	font-style: normal;
}

p{
	text-align:justify;
	}

/*---------- MAIN CSS -----------*/

body  {
 background:#000000 url(../images2/bg_back2.gif) left top repeat-x;
 font:normal 12px/16px Arial, Helvetica, sans-serif;
 color:#000000;
 text-decoration:none;
 text-transform:none;
 font-style:normal;
 font-variant:normal;
 }
 
#outer_frame  {
 width:100%;
 margin:0px auto;
 padding:12px 0 0 0;
 background:url(../images2/bg_back_top.png) center top no-repeat;
 }
 
#inner_frame  {
 width:938px;
 margin:0px auto;
 padding:15px 0 0 0;
 overflow:hidden;
 background:url(../images2/header_bg.png) left top no-repeat;
 position:relative;
}

/*---*/

#inner_frame .flash_frame  {
  width:222px;
  height:589px;
  left:19px;
  top:165px;
  position:absolute;
  z-index:1;
  }
  
/*---*/

#inner_frame #main_nav_frame  {
 width:198px;
 position:absolute;
 left:21px;
 top:169px;
 background:url(../images2/nav_bg.png) 0 0 no-repeat;
 height:203px;
 z-index:2;
 padding:10px 0 0 12px;
 }
 

/*---------- CLASSES -----------*/

.clear  {
 font-size:0px; 
 line-height:0px; 
 clear:both;
 }
 
/*---------- HEADER -----------*/
 
#header  {
 width:938px;
 height:466px;
 padding:0 0 0 0;
 position:relative;
 }
 
#header .logo {
 width:153px;
 height:95px;
 top:30px;
 left:52px;
 position:absolute;
 }
 
#header .slogan {
 width:368px;
 height:62px;
 top:38px;
 left:258px;
 position:absolute;
 }
 
#header #header_content_frame  {
 width:200px;
 top:175px;
 left:285px;
 position:absolute;
 }
 
#header_content_frame ul  {
 width:200px;
 overflow:hidden;
 }
 
 #header_content_frame ul  li {
 width:200px;
 height:auto;
 margin:0 0 2px 0;
 }
 
#header_content_frame ul  li a {
 display:block;
 background:url(../images2/tea_icon.png) left 2px no-repeat;
 text-indent:40px;
 font:bold 13px/33px 'Square721BTRoman';
 color:#050607;
 text-transform:uppercase;
 }
 
#header_content_frame ul  li a:hover {
  text-decoration:underline;
  color:#4f731b;
 }
 
/*#header_content_frame h1 span  {
 color:#000000;
 }
 
#header_content_frame p {
 width:167px;
 font:normal 12px/16px Arial, Helvetica, sans-serif;
 color:#000000;
 margin:0 0 10px 0;
 padding:0 0 0 8px;
 display:block;
 text-align:justify;
 float:left;
 }
 
#header_content_frame .read_more  {
 width:167px;
 background:url(../images2/arrow.png) left 5px no-repeat;
 text-indent:12px;
 font:normal 11px Arial, Helvetica, sans-serif;
 color:#023f61;
 margin-left:8px;
 float:left;
 }
 
#header_content_frame .read_more a  {
 color:#023f61;
 }
 
#header_content_frame .read_more a:hover  {
 text-decoration:underline;
 }*/
 
/*---------- BODY-FRAME -----------*/

#body_frame {
 width:898px;
 padding:0 20px 0 20px;
 background:url(../images2/frame_shadwo2.png) 1px 0 repeat-y;
 }
 
#body {
 width:898px;
 background:url(../images2/left_panel_bg.png) left top repeat-y;
 overflow:hidden;
 position:relative;
 }

#body .body_bottom_bg  {
 width:676px;
 height:99px;
 right:0px;
 bottom:0px;
 position:absolute;
 }
 
 
/*---------- LEFT-PANEL -----------*/ 

#left_panel  {
 width:222px;
 float:left;
 height:463px;
 padding:0 0 92px 0;
 position:relative;
 }
 
#left_panel #world_map  {
 width:218px;
 left:0;
 bottom:92px;
 z-index:2;
 position:absolute;
 background:url(../images2/map2.gif) 0 0 no-repeat;
 padding-top:97px;
 }
 
#world_map .click{
 width:218px;
 background:url(../images2/arrow2.PNG) 40px 6px no-repeat;
 text-indent:54px;
 font:normal 12px tahoma;
 color:#1f2c33;
 }
 
#world_map .click a{
 color:#1f2c33;
 }
 
#world_map .click a:hover{
 color:#000000;
 text-decoration:underline;
 }
 
/*---------- RIGHT-PANEL -----------*/ 

#right_panel  {
 width:630px;
 float:left;
 overflow:hidden;
 padding:0 0 99px 46px;
 }
 
#right_panel #left_frame  {
  width:267px;
  float:left;
  overflow:hidden;
  background:url(../images2/body_divider.png) right 60px no-repeat;
  }
  
/*---*/
   
#growth {
 float:left;
 margin:0 0 27px 0;
 width:215px;
 }
 
#growth .growth_img{
 float:left;
 margin:0 0 16px 0;
 width:190px;
 text-align:center;
 height:auto;
 }
 
#growth h2  {
 width:200px;
 background:url(../images2/logo_simbol.png) left 1px no-repeat;
 text-indent:19px;
 margin:0 0 12px 0;
 font:bold 13px 'Square721BTRoman';
 color:#4f731b;
 text-transform:uppercase;
 display:block;
 float:left;
 }
 
#growth h2 span  {
 color:#000000;
 }
 
#growth p {
 width:200px;
 font:normal 12px/18px Arial, Helvetica, sans-serif;
 color:#000000;
 margin:0 0 10px 0;
 padding:0 0 0 8px;
 display:block;
 float:left;
 text-align:justify;
 }
 
#growth .read_more2  {
 width:80px;
 background:url(../images2/arrow.png) left 5px no-repeat;
 text-indent:12px;
 font:normal 11px Arial, Helvetica, sans-serif;
 color:#023f61;
 float:right;
 }
 
#growth .read_more2 a  {
 color:#4f731b;
 }
 
#growth .read_more2 a:hover  {
 text-decoration:underline;
 }
 
 
/*---*/
   
#projects {
 float:left;
 margin:0 0 27px 0;
 width:215px;
 }
 
#projects .projects_img{
 float:left;
 margin:0 0 16px 0;
 width:190px;
 text-align:center;
 height:auto;
 }
 
#projects h2  {
 width:200px;
 background:url(../images2/logo_simbol.png) left 1px no-repeat;
 text-indent:19px;
 margin:0 0 12px 0;
 font:bold 13px 'Square721BTRoman';
 color:#4f731b;
 text-transform:uppercase;
 display:block;
 float:left;
 }
 
#projects h2 span  {
 color:#000000;
 }
 
#projects p {
 width:180px;
 font:normal 12px/18px Arial, Helvetica, sans-serif;
 color:#000000;
 margin:0 0 25px 0;
 padding:0 0 0 8px;
 display:block;
 float:left;
 text-align:justify;
 }
 
#projects .read_more3  {
 width:80px;
 background:url(../images2/arrow.png) left 5px no-repeat;
 text-indent:12px;
 font:normal 11px Arial, Helvetica, sans-serif;
 color:#023f61;
 float:right;
 }
 
#projects .read_more3 a  {
 color:#4f731b;
 }
 
#projects .read_more3 a:hover  {
 text-decoration:underline;
 }
 
 
/*----*/

#right_panel #right_frame  {
  width:267px;
  float:left;
  overflow:hidden;
  padding:0 0 0 66px;
  }
  
/*---*/
   
#prime_sectors {
 float:left;
 margin:0 0 27px 0;
 width:215px;
 }
 
#prime_sectors .prime_sectors_img{
 float:left;
 margin:0 0 16px 0;
 width:190px;
 text-align:center;
 height:auto;
 }
 
#prime_sectors h2  {
 width:200px;
 background:url(../images2/logo_simbol.png) left 1px no-repeat;
 text-indent:19px;
 margin:0 0 12px 0;
 font:bold 13px 'Square721BTRoman';
 color:#4f731b;
 text-transform:uppercase;
 display:block;
 float:left;
 }
 
#prime_sectors h2 span  {
 color:#000000;
 }
 
#prime_sectors p {
 width:200px;
 font:normal 12px/18px Arial, Helvetica, sans-serif;
 color:#000000;
 margin:0 0 14px 0;
 padding:0 0 0 8px;
 display:block;
 float:left;
 text-align:justify;
 }
 
#prime_sectors .read_more4  {
 width:70px;
 background:url(../images2/arrow.png) left 5px no-repeat;
 text-indent:12px;
 font:normal 11px Arial, Helvetica, sans-serif;
 color:#023f61;
 float:right;
 }
 
#prime_sectors .read_more4 a  {
 color:#4f731b;
 }
 
#prime_sectors .read_more4 a:hover  {
 text-decoration:underline;
 }
 

/*---*/
   
#men_behind {
 float:left;
 margin:0 0 27px 0;
 width:215px;
 }
 
#men_behind .men_behind_img{
 float:left;
 margin:0 0 16px 0;
 width:190px;
 text-align:center;
 height:auto;
 }
 
#men_behind h2  {
 width:200px;
 background:url(../images2/logo_simbol.png) left 1px no-repeat;
 text-indent:19px;
 margin:0 0 12px 0;
 font:bold 13px 'Square721BTRoman';
 color:#4f731b;
 text-transform:uppercase;
 display:block;
 float:left;
 }
 
#men_behind h2 span  {
 color:#000000;
 }
 
#men_behind p {
 width:200px;
 font:normal 12px/18px Arial, Helvetica, sans-serif;
 color:#000000;
 margin:0 0 14px 0;
 padding:0 0 0 8px;
 display:block;
 float:left;
 text-align:justify;
 }
 
#men_behind .read_more5  {
 width:70px;
 background:url(../images2/arrow.png) left 5px no-repeat;
 text-indent:12px;
 font:normal 11px Arial, Helvetica, sans-serif;
 color:#023f61;
 float:right;
 }
 
#men_behind .read_more5 a  {
 color:#4f731b;
 }
 
#men_behind .read_more5 a:hover  {
 text-decoration:underline;
 }
 
 
/*---------- FOOTER -----------*/ 

#footer_frame  {
 width:900px;
 background:#1b391f url(../images2/footer_bg.gif) left top no-repeat;
 overflow:hidden;
 padding:24px 0 24px 0;
 margin:0 0 0 19px;
 text-align:center;
 }
 
#footer_frame ul   {
 width:450px;
 margin:0px auto;
 overflow:hidden;
 display:block;
 }
 
#footer_frame ul li {
 width:auto;
 font:normal 10px tahoma;
 color:#ffffff;
 text-transform:uppercase;
 background:url(../images2/nav_line2.gif) right 2px no-repeat;
 padding:0 10px 0 9px;
 display:block;
 float:left;
 }
 
#footer_frame ul li a{
 color:#ffffff;
 }
 
#footer_frame ul li a:hover{
 color:#d0b870;
 }
 
/* ====================CTC Tea======================*/
.background_header ul 
{
margin: 0px; padding: 0px; background-color:#207526;  height: 24px; width:600px; 
}
.background_header ul li 
{
margin: 0px auto; padding: 0px 26px 0px 26px; float: left; list-style: none; color: #237428; font-weight: bold; line-height: 24px; border-left: 1px solid #fff;display:block;
}

.background_header ul li a
{
color: #fff; text-decoration: none;
}

.background_header ul li a:hover
{
color: #fff; text-decoration: underline;
}

/*Paragraph heading */
.pageheading
{
padding:15px 0 0px 0;
margin:0px;
font-family: Arial, Helvetica, sans-serif;
font-weight:bold;
font-size: 14px;
color:#353536;
line-height: 28px;
}
/* End Paragraph  heading end*/

 /* ====================CTC Tea end======================*/
 
 /* ====================tea facts ======================*/ 
 .teafacts ul{
padding-top:0;
margin-top:0;
list-style:none;
}
.teafacts li{
font-family:arial, Verdana, Arial;
font-size:12px;
font-weight:bold;
color:#cf2525;
line-height:18px;
background:url(../images/bullet_tealeaf.jpg) left 4px no-repeat;
padding:0 0 0 25px;
}
.teafacts li a{
font-family:arial, Verdana, Arial;
font-size:12px;
font-weight:bold;
color:#333;
line-height:14px;
text-decoration:none;
outline:none;
}
.teafacts li a:hover{
font-family:arial, Verdana, Arial;
font-size:12px;
font-weight:bold;
color:#cf2525;
line-height:14px;
text-decoration:none;
}

.query{
font-family:arial, Arial, Verdana;
font-size:12px;
font-weight:bold;
height:20px;
color:#FF0000;
}
.ans{
font-family:arial, Verdana, Arial;
font-size:12px;
font-weight:normal;
color:#333333;
padding-left:5px;
line-height:18px;
}
 
 .tearecipes ul{
list-style-type:none;
padding-top:0;
margin-top:0;
}
.tearecipes li{
font-family:arial, Verdana, Arial;
font-size:12px;
font-weight:bold;
color:#333;
line-height:18px;
background:url(../images/bullet_tealeaf.jpg) left 4px no-repeat;
padding:0 0 0 25px;
}
.tearecipes li a{
font-family:arial, Verdana, Arial;
font-size:12px;
font-weight:bold;
color:#333;
line-height:18px;
text-decoration:none;
}
.tearecipes li a:hover{
font-family:arial, Verdana, Arial;
font-size:12px;
font-weight:bold;
color:#009933;
line-height:18px;
text-decoration:none;
}
 /* ====================tea facts end======================*/
